What is Open Text's finite lived intangible assets - gross?
Open Text (OTEX) reported finite lived intangible assets - gross of $3.3B in Q1 2026.
How has Open Text's finite lived intangible assets - gross changed year-over-year?
Open Text's finite lived intangible assets - gross decreased by 12.8% year-over-year, from $3.79B to $3.3B.
What is the long-term trend for Open Text's finite lived intangible assets - gross?
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Open Text's finite lived intangible assets - gross has grown at a 11.5%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$2.39B to $3.7B.
What does finite lived intangible assets - gross mean?
This metric tracks the total historical cost of intangible assets that have a defined useful life, such as patents, software licenses, or customer relationships. It excludes assets with indefinite lives like certain trademarks or goodwill. It is a key indicator of the company's investment in intellectual property and intangible competitive advantages.
